Output 51e893ec455528fa3bd03e5c6c77c0efe6717795dc12f96e99f021c57c56e16f:151

value
39921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b811b69eda2bd8ed9e8e1eebb8e15f5c16fed8c OP_EQUAL
address
35f3eJw5srqA3Ke1yMnCNdR6VwWWb7UG3Y
transaction
51e893ec455528fa3bd03e5c6c77c0efe6717795dc12f96e99f021c57c56e16f
spent
true